Review of Touching the Void (2003) by Jens S — 11 May 2007
This documentary about a failed attempt to climb down a peruvian mountain suffers from one big problem: both mountaineers tell the tale, so you know it ends well. The mix of them telling the events and impressive reinacted scenes entertains anyhow, some parts are almost unbearable in their realism, when you can almost feel the cold and height.
The story itself is almost unbelievable, a classic tale of mind over matter and never giving up.
